Sztuka kodowania. Sekrety wielkich programistów
Dane szczegółowe: | |
Wydawca: | Helion |
Rok wyd.: | 2011 |
Oprawa: | miękka |
Ilość stron: | 408 s. |
Wymiar: | 168x237 mm |
EAN: | 9788324627554 |
ISBN: | 978-83-246-2755-4 |
Data: | 2011-01-21 |
Opis książki:
Zajrzyj bezkarnie programiście przez ramię!- Czym naprawdę jest programowanie?
- Jak swoją przygodę rozpoczynali wielcy tej branży?
- Czy istnieje bezbłędny program?
Programiści to tajemnicze osoby, które potrafią zmusić komputery do wykonywania karkołomnych zadań, wymyślanych przez zwykłych użytkowników. Spędzają cały dzień przed komputerem, a ich świat to monitor, klawiatura i hektolitry kawy. Czy to prawda? Na to pytanie odpowiada książka, którą trzymasz w rękach. Dzięki niej spojrzysz na ten zawód z zupełnie innego punktu widzenia. Jej autor przeprowadza wywiady z najbardziej rozpoznawalnymi osobami z tej branży. Mówią one o swoich pierwszych krokach w świecie programowania, opowiadają, jak nauczyły się swojego pierwszego języka oraz jak widzą tę gałąź wiedzy w przyszłości.
Czym naprawdę jest programowanie? Rzemiosłem, sztuką, a może nauką? Te pytania stawia autor we wprowadzeniu i ma nadzieję, że wypowiedzi jego gości choć trochę zbliżą go do znalezienia odpowiedzi. Ta unikalna książka pozwoli Ci poznać bliżej wybitne osoby, od lat związane z informatyką. Anegdoty, ciekawe opowieści, wiele przykładów to tylko niektóre z proponowanych przez nią atrakcji. Zagłębiając się w kolejne wypowiedzi, przekonasz się, jak często przypadek decyduje o sukcesie lub porażce.
W trakcie lektury będziesz mieć okazję zapoznać się z wypowiedziami takich sław, jak:
- Jamie Zawinski - wybitny programista Lisp, pracujący przy pierwszych wersjach przeglądarki Netscape
- Brad Fitzpatrick - najmłodsza osoba w gronie, programistaod zawsze"
- Douglas Crockford - starszy architekt Java Script w Yahoo!; pomysłodawca formatu JSON
- Brendan Eich - twórca języka Java Script
- Joshua Bloch - szef Java Architect w Google; w trakcie pracy w Sun Microsystem był kierownikiem zespołu projektującego i implementującego Java Collections Framework
- Joe Armstrong - autor języka programowania Erlang
- Simon Peyton Jones - rozpoczął projekt, którego efektem było powstanie języka Haskell
- Peter Norvig - dyrektor działu badań w Google, wcześniej pracujący dla NASA
- Guy Steele - znawca języków; Cobol, Fortran, PDP-10, Java, Haskell to tylko niektóre z jego repertuaru
- Dan Ingalls - współtwórca języka Smalltalk
- L. Peter Deutsch - programista od końca lat pięćdziesiątych; zaczynał w wieku jedenastu lat
- Ken Thompson - współtwórca systemu UNIX
- Fran Allen - przez czterdzieści pięć lat pracował dla firmy IBM; instruktor języka Fortran
- Bernie Cosell - współautor oprogramowania wykorzystywanego w pierwszych węzłach sieci ARPANET
- Donald Knuth - autor jedynego najprawdopodobniej bezbłędnego programu - Te X
Książka "Sztuka kodowania. Sekrety wielkich programistów" - oprawa miękka - Wydawnictwo Helion. Książka posiada 408 stron i została wydana w 2011 r.